آموزش برنامه های Building React و ASP.NET MVC 5

Building React and ASP.NET MVC 5 Applications

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: React.js یک چارچوب محبوب است که به خصوص برای ساخت برنامه های وب با ASP.NET MVC 5 مناسب است ، اما ادغام این دو چارچوب می تواند چالش برانگیز باشد. در این دوره ، مدرس Kazi نصرت علی چگونگی اتصال این دو چارچوب را برای توسعه برنامه های وب React و ASP.NET MVC 5 کامل می کند. بیاموزید که چگونه با ایجاد یک برنامه وب پشته کامل برای یک رستوران ، یک قسمت جلویی با React.js و یک backend با ASP.NET MVC 5 و Entity Framework ایجاد کنید. ورود کاربر ایجاد کنید ، قابلیت سبد خرید را به برنامه خود اضافه کنید ، API را ایمن کنید و برای تلفن همراه بهینه کنید. با پایان دادن به این دوره ، مهارت های لازم برای ترکیب قدرت React.js و ASP.NET MVC 5 برای ایجاد صفحات وب با کیفیت و تأثیرگذار را خواهید داشت.
موضوعات شامل:
  • ایجاد قسمت انتهایی
  • داربست پروژه با MVC 5
  • تنظیم API سرویس برای داده ها
  • ایجاد قسمت جلویی با React
  • مدیریت رویدادها برای عناصر React
  • رابط کاربر پاسخگو و دوستی موبایل
  • امنیت API
  • اشکال زدایی قسمت جلویی و انتهای عقب

سرفصل ها و درس ها

مقدمه Introduction

  • قدرت React و ASP.NET MVC 5 The power of React and ASP.NET MVC 5

  • آنچه باید بدانید What you should know

  • محیط توسعه را تنظیم کنید Set up the development environment

1. درباره ASP.NET MVC 5 و React 1. About ASP.NET MVC 5 and React

  • بررسی اجمالی سریع برنامه ASP.NET MVC 5 ، React و Full Stack ASP.NET MVC 5, React, and full-stack app quick overview

  • چرا با ASP.NET MVC 5 واکنش نشان می دهیم؟ Why React with ASP.NET MVC 5?

  • برنامه React و ASP.NET MVC که ساختیم The React and ASP.NET MVC app we are building

2. Back End را ایجاد کنید 2. Create the Back End

  • داربست یک پروژه با MVC 5 Scaffold a project with MVC 5

  • مدل های داده را برای Entity Framework اضافه کنید Add data models for Entity Framework

  • اضافه کردن Entity Framework DbContext Add Entity Framework DbContext

  • روش های کنترل کننده را برای صفحات UI ایجاد کنید Create controller methods for UI pages

  • نمایش ثبت نام و ورود به سیستم اضافه کنید Add register and login views

  • ثبت نام از آزمون و ویژگی های ورود به سیستم Test register and login features

3. تنظیم: یک API سرویس برای داده ها 3. Setup: A Service API for Data

  • یک کنترلر API REST ایجاد کنید Create a REST API controller

  • برای خواندن سوابق با فرمت JSON یک روش عملی اضافه کنید Add an action method to read records in JSON format

  • برای ایجاد رکوردها یک روش عملی اضافه کنید Add an action method to create records

4- تنظیم: TypeScript ، IntelliSense و صفحه وب 4. Setup: TypeScript, IntelliSense, and webpack

  • مسئله توسعه محیط با React و Visual Studio 2015 The dev environment issue with React and Visual Studio 2015

  • صفحه وب ، TypeScript و پیکربندی ها را تنظیم کنید Set up webpack, TypeScript, and configs

  • React را تنظیم کنید و تعاریف و پیکربندی ها را تایپ کنید Set up React and type definitions and configs

5- Front React را با React ایجاد کنید 5. Create the Front End with React

  • یک کلاس داده واقعی و کلاس های حالت اضافه کنید Add a React data model and state classes

  • یک مؤلفه React اضافه کنید و داده بارگیری کنید Add a React component and fetch data

  • داده ها را به عنوان شبکه ای از جعبه ها ارائه دهید Render data as a grid of boxes

  • قابلیت سبد خرید را با React اضافه کنید Add shopping cart functionality with React

  • در ادامه اضافه کردن قابلیت های سبد خرید Continuing to add shopping cart functionality

  • رسیدگی به رویدادها برای عناصر React Handling events for React elements

  • مؤلفه فرم React را برای ارسال داده اضافه کنید Add React form component to submit data

  • UI پاسخگو و دوستی با موبایل Responsive UI and mobile friendliness

6. API را ایمن کنید 6. Secure the API

  • درک آسیب پذیری API Understanding the API vulnerability

  • API را با AutizeAttribute امن کنید Secure the API with AuthorizeAttribute

7. اشکال زدایی و آزمایش 7. Debugging and Testing

  • اشکال زدایی قسمت جلویی و عقب Debugging the front end and back end

  • تست و تکمیل Testing and completion

نتیجه Conclusion

  • مراحل بعدی Next steps

نمایش نظرات

آموزش برنامه های Building React و ASP.NET MVC 5
جزییات دوره
2h 11m
31
Linkedin (لینکدین) Linkedin (لینکدین)
(آخرین آپدیت)
19,323
- از 5
ندار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Kazi Nasrat Ali Kazi Nasrat Ali

Kazi Nasrat Ali یک توسعه دهنده ارشد نرم افزار در Surge است که در C # ، .NET و Azure تخصص دارد. Kazi دارای 15+ سال تجربه چند بعدی در توسعه نرم افزارهای مبتنی بر اینترنت و وب است. این تجربه شامل طراحی ، تجزیه و تحلیل ، برنامه ریزی ، تصمیم گیری ، آزمایش ، عیب یابی و انجام تجزیه و تحلیل علت اصلی است. علاوه بر تخصص در C # ، .NET و Azure ، در زمینه خدمات وب ، MVC ، SQL Server ، JavaScript و jQuery نیز مهارت دارد.